Stable 8'0" Standard Softboards
Standard softboards are 8'0" foam boards with an IXPE top, HDPE bottom, EPS construction and an SF5 through-deck fin setup; the dimensions are 8’0 x 23’’ x 3 1/2’’ (77.8 liters).
Premium Softboards — Reinforced and Handy
Premium softboards add a high-density IXPE top, reinforced EPS construction, handles for transport, the same SF5 through-deck fin setup and slightly greater volume at 8’0 x 23’’ x 3 3/4’’ (90 liters).
Single Hardboard Option — 7'2" Malibu
For riders wanting a more performance-oriented shape there is one 7'2" EPS Flow Rider Malibu: an epoxy Malibu with a strong biaxial construction and thruster fin setup, sized 7’2 x 21 3/4’’ x 2 5/8’’ (49.5 liters).

Practical planner
Details to review before reserving
Standard and premium softboards are listed at £15; all rented boards must be brought back by 5pm.
Standard softboard: 8’0 x 23’’ x 3 1/2’’ – 77.8 ltrs; Premium softboard: 8’0 x 23’’ x 3 3/4’’ – 90 ltrs; Hardboard: 7’2 x 21 3/4’’ x 2 5/8’’ – 49.5 ltrs.
Softboards use an SF5 through-deck fin setup with IXPE tops and EPS construction; the hardboard uses a biaxial tech thruster fin setup and epoxy construction.
